Human Readiness: Empowering People in an Agentic World
Agentic Process Automation (APA) promises smarter, faster, more autonomous workflows—but it only works if your people are ready. In this edition, we explore how to prepare your workforce for a future of human–agent collaboration, covering mindset, skills, and change leadership.
As intelligent agents become part of the modern workforce, one thing is clear: technology alone isn’t enough.
Agentic Process Automation (APA) shifts how work gets done. It’s not just about automating repetitive tasks—it’s about creating autonomous agents that can make decisions, adapt in real time, and act with limited human oversight.
But there’s a catch: if your people aren’t ready, the agents won’t succeed.
We often say APA is a digital transformation. In truth, it’s just as much a cultural and organisational transformation. That means human readiness needs to be at the core of your APA strategy.

Leadership & Vision: It Starts at the Top
The potential value of APA is immense. Done right, it can improve decision-making, boost productivity, and fundamentally reshape how work gets done. But unlike traditional automation initiatives that could be delivered in siloed departments, APA touches nearly every part of the business.
It affects people’s roles, how teams interact, how data flows, and how systems integrate. These are not changes that can be managed from the middle. They require clear direction from the top.

The Rise of Agentic AI and its Benefits for Healthcare Organisations
Agentic AI represents a revolutionary shift in artificial intelligence, characterised by its ability to operate autonomously, proactively address problems, and adapt to complex environments without constant human oversight. Unlike traditional AI systems, which follow predefined instructions to perform specific tasks, agentic AI is designed to make independent decisions, learn from its environment, and collaborate with other systems to achieve overarching objectives. This technological evolution is poised to transform healthcare, a sector increasingly reliant on advanced solutions to meet rising demands for efficiency, personalisation, and improved patient outcomes.

RPA and Intelligent Automation: Complementary Technologies, Not System Replacements
A common misconception persists: that RPA and IA are meant to replace existing systems. In reality, these technologies do not replace legacy or core systems but rather complement them, enhancing their capabilities without the need for significant overhauls. This article explores how RPA and IA sit on top of existing systems, serving as a bridge to modern innovation while preserving the valuable infrastructure that businesses rely on.
